Space-Saving
A mantel package electric fire is a great alternative for renters and homeowners who want to add a stylish touch to their home. Contrary to traditional gas or wood fireplaces, these models don't require costly construction permits, permits, or venting and are often installed in just 30 minutes. They also eliminate the need for chimney cleaning and service checks and the associated high maintenance and fuel costs.
The mantel is typically constructed from high-quality materials such as stone or wood. It adds style and sophistication to any room. Available in a range of designs, from classic and timeless to cutting-edge contemporary, there is an electric fireplace mantel collection to match any decor.
The efficiency of heat generated by electric fires is a key feature. While traditional wood and gas fires can be extremely inefficient electric fires convert nearly all of the electricity they use into heat. Many models also offer adjustable heat settings so you can customize your heating capabilities to your individual requirements.
Electric fireplaces are safe for homes with children and pets. They don't have an open flame, they are less likely to start an incident that could ignite a fire in your home than their natural counterparts, and they don't produce any harmful fumes. In addition, they do not require a flue or chimney for operation, so you can safely install them anywhere.
While many prefer a wall-mounted or built in electric fire to go with their existing fireplace, freestanding electric fireplace heater with mantel models are a great alternative for those with limited area for flooring. They can be easily moved and placed anyplace to create an area of interest. They also offer an additional place to display framed photographs and other decorative items.
Another benefit of having an electric fireplace is that it can be used all year round even when you're not in need of the warmth. Certain models let you enjoy the visual effects without turning on the heater, and some even come with the "flame-only" setting to use during summer.
Electric fireplaces can be adapted to fit in with any decor. Certain models have unique features like the carved logs, stone surrounds or crown molding, which add character to the space. Other models have features that are flexible like a customizable display area for framed photos or other ornaments, as well as smart-home compatibility that allows you to control your fire from your tablet or smartphone.
Safety
slim electric fireplace with mantel fireplaces are much safer for pets and children when compared to traditional wood-burning and gas fireplaces. The flames aren't able to burn pets or people if they get close because there isn't a burning fire. In addition, there aren't sparks that fly out or hazardous gases released by the flame that could cause injuries or poisoning.
Furthermore, many electric fireplaces feature a shield that remains cool to the touch even when the heat is turned up. This prevents anyone from being burned if they accidentally touched the fireplace. Some of these units have timers that can be set up to shut off the fireplace on a scheduled basis. This feature helps reduce the energy consumption and reduces electric bills.
The style of the fireplace can be a factor in how safe it is to use. It is crucial to select an appliance made of top materials that have a solid structure. This will ensure that it's sturdy and durable and will be more resistant to wear and tear.
Think about the weight of whatever you are planning to put on top of your fireplace. Items that weigh a lot, like mirrors or framed works art, can put too much strain on the fireplace and may cause it to bend over time. It is therefore recommended to choose a fireplace that has an elongated mantel and corbels that are capable of supporting the weight of the items that you intend to exhibit.
When you are deciding where to put your fireplace, you need to also consider the dimensions of other elements in the room. Mounting it too high can make the space feel crowded and prevent it from displaying the look of a real fireplace. Mounting it too low can make it difficult to reach or use.
In the end, you should consider the heating capacity of the fireplace into account when choosing one. The BTUs and wattage of your fireplace will determine the temperature of your home and how much you'll pay to run it. You should also read the manual carefully to know how to operate your fireplace and the safety precautions you need to take.

Low Maintenance
If you're looking to increase the ambiance of a fireplace, but without the hassle of dealing with wood and ash the electric mantel suite is an ideal solution. These models are easier to maintain because they do not release harmful fumes or have an open flame. Some models also include the option of adjusting the settings.
Fireplaces are available in various sizes, so you can choose one that best suits your needs. You can browse online and in stores to find the model that best suits your needs. You can consult an electrician to help you choose the best one for your home. They can ensure that the electrical system is capable of handling the suite, and that it is safe to use.
Look for a fire that is electric that has several heating settings. This gives you the ability to change the flame and ember bed colors as well as the level of heat. A more flexible unit allows you to pick the most appropriate setting for the space that you're in, and it'll be able to meet the needs of your family members.
Another aspect to consider when looking for an electric fireplace with mantel is the design and the material it's constructed from. You can choose from metal, wood, or cast stone. Each type has its own benefits and disadvantages. Wood is a favorite choice because it's sturdy, flexible, and can be painted or stained to match your home's colour scheme. Cast stone is another popular option due to its long-lasting and comes in many different finishes. It's also easy to mount and can be stained or painted to match your style preferences.
When selecting a mantel for you to mount, remember that it must be positioned at least 12 inches higher than the opening of the firebox. This is recommended by the National Fire Protection Agency to prevent any damage to your home and ensure that the room is up to the standards of fire safety. You can also add support to the structure by installing corbels. It is a decorative element that adds to the overall appearance of the structure and can also be used as a bracket to support heavy items like mirrors or framed works of art.
